Job description

Job Description

Dewberry is seeking a highly motivated and detail oriented Mechanical Engineering Intern for Summer 2027 to work with a project team and assist in the design of building mechanical system projects for our Raleigh, NC office.

Dewberry is a leading, market-facing professional services firm with more than 60 locations and 2,500 professionals nationwide. What sets us apart from our competitors is our people. At Dewberry, we seek out exceptional talent and strive to deliver the highest quality of services to our clients. Whether you're an experienced professional or a new graduate, you'll have the chance to collaborate with the best and brightest and work on innovative and complex projects at the forefront of the industry. Our commitment to excellence stems from our personal integrity and from other defining attributes, which we call "Dewberry at Work," that haveinspired our employees to be successful for more than a half-century.

Responsibilities

The position requires a strong technical background, excellence in design, attention to detail and quality control, and the ability to work in a team environment. Projects may include; new multi-building facilities, retrofit projects, laboratory, mission critical facilities, as well as energy conservation studies, facility condition assessments, and due diligence reports addressing operating conditions and construction costs.

Program Information

Summer Intern Program

During the summer intern program, interns gain hands-on project experience, develop technical skills, and put their classroom knowledge into action. Our interns are assigned meaningful work and are given the opportunity to work on projects similar to what they would be engaging with as a full-time employee.

Our interns get the opportunity to participate in a series of workshops and events, including:

  • Networking opportunities to meet other interns, staff, and senior leaders across the business.
  • Learning about our services, projects, and clients.
  • Professional development workshops, including a career planning workshop and a DiSC assessment to learn more about themselves and how to work effectively with others.
  • Summer-long group project where interns work alongside firm leaders to address issues that will impact our future strategy.
